Enhanced dielectric properties in (In, Nb) co-doped BaTiO 3 ceramics

ABSTRACT
Abstract BaTi1-x(In0.5Nb0.5)xO3 (x = 0, 0.01, and 0.03) ceramic samples were prepared using the conventional solid-state reaction method. The dielectric properties of these samples were investigated as a function of temperature (300 K ≤ T ≤ 700 K) and frequency (102 Hz ≤ f ≤ 106 Hz). Great enhancement of dielectric constant in the dual doped samples was found. Defect diploles of [Nb Ti 5 + - Ti 3 + ] and [Nb Ti 5 + - In Ti 3 + ] were suggest to account for the enhancement of dielectric constant.
